My colleague inadvertently introduced me to this dessert place in SS15 that is manned by her friends – a Taiwanese husband and Malaysian wife team. The dynamic duo has been working on the menu and the recipes prior to the opening of their brainchild – Snowflake. The husband even worked in one of the dessert places in Taiwan to learn how to operate a restaurant. And now they have opened a second outlet in Pavilion Mall within a year; this is a true recognition of the care and effort they put into making the dessert place a special place for guests to stay and dine.

I managed to persuade KampungBoy to give the place a try by telling him that Snowflake’s Taro Ball is as good as the one from Jiufen, Taiwan.  The Pavilion outlet is more like a kiosk, unlike the spacious setting in SS15. Once you have placed your order, the waiting staff will give you a cute device – beeping UFO. It will beeps and vibrates to let you know that your desserts are ready!

We had the Snowflake Bestseller (RM6.50) with grass jelly, grass jelly ice , taro balls and creamer.

And proceed to dig in! The taro balls were pleasantly chewy with a light hint of yam; almost as good as those taro balls from 阿柑姨芋圓 Ah Gan Yee Taro Balls in Jiufen, Taiwan. The grass jelly and grass jelly flavoured shaved ice was really refreshing and cooling. Snowflake’s desserts are perfect for someone who is looking for something not too sweet and a quick cool down from the scorching heat.
